Loss of IGF‐1R impairs DNA‐PKcs recruitment to chromatin leading to defective end‐joining

open access: yesMolecular Oncology, EarlyView.
IGF‐1R promotes radioresistance by facilitating DNA‐PKcs recruitment to chromatin, enabling non‐homologous end‐joining (NHEJ) repair of double‐strand breaks. Inhibition or loss of IGF‐1R disrupts this recruitment to damage sites, driving compensatory reliance on microhomology‐mediated end‐joining (MMEJ) repair.

Small molecule adsorption on defective phosphorene

open access: yesMolecular Physics
We perform Density Functional Theory calculations to determine adsorption energies of small gas molecules (H2, N2, NO, and CO) on defective, vacancy-laden, black phosphorene. Different configurations of single and double vacancies in the monolayer structure are considered, together with several possible adsorption sites onto them.

MITF maintains genome stability in nonmelanocyte lineages

open access: yesMolecular Oncology, EarlyView.
MITF is essential for melanocyte survival and acts as an oncogene in 10%–20% of melanomas. We show that MITF depletion causes genome instability in nonmelanocytic cells, leading to LATS2‐mediated P53 activation, cell cycle arrest, and apoptosis. Small bowel obstruction caused by congenital transmesenteric defect

open access: yesAfrican Journal of Paediatric Surgery, 2011
Transmesenteric hernias are extremely rare. A strangulated hernia through a mesenteric opening is a rare operative finding. Preoperative diagnosis still is difficult in spite of the imaging techniques currently available.
